Internet Messaging: Why Errors Multiply and What Consequences for Users
Professional email reigns supreme in business exchanges. But as inboxes fill up, common errors become the norm. A misspelled first name, an address slipped in by habit, a forgotten attachment: these missteps are numerous and spare no one. Even trendy platforms, like Bbox messaging, expose their users to mishaps, as speed and automation blur vigilance.

The discomfort doesn’t stop at embarrassment: a recipient error, for example, can become disastrous. Lost confidential information, tarnished professional reputation, financial losses lurking… A simple email can turn a routine into a crisis. Add to this the habit of recycling passwords or sending credentials via email – an open door for data breaches. It is estimated that 80% of security flaws originate from these weak or reused passwords. Too many employees, out of haste or ignorance, still let slip information that should never have left their screen.
- A strategic data evaporates due to an unfortunate send
- Phishing and spam proliferate on the weaknesses of professional emails
- Client or partner trust wavers after an address blunder
Vigilance is also necessary for email accounts of departed employees: every forgotten active account becomes a breach. And when the office email is used to order sneakers or sign up for a newsletter, exposure to threats increases. Every message is like a link in your digital heritage: it’s better to tighten the ranks, as messaging today structures all professional interactions.

Pitfalls to Absolutely Avoid to Secure and Optimize Your Online Exchanges
When it comes to exchange security, improvisation has no place. Forgetting to encrypt a message containing sensitive data is extending a hand to hackers: interception, leakage, exploitation, anything becomes possible. Activating multi-factor authentication on your messaging is no longer a luxury but a necessity, as the number of intrusions skyrockets.
Taking care of written quality changes the game. An email saturated with mistakes, riddled with vague phrases or nebulous subjects, erodes credibility. A clear, concise, personalized subject line – without shouting in capital letters – grabs attention and facilitates understanding. A detail? No, a key to being read and understood.
- Proofread each message before clicking “send”
- Ensure that the promised attachment is indeed included in the email
- Avoid no-reply addresses if you wish to open a dialogue
Regarding email campaigns, buying or renting mailing lists is like cutting the branch you’re sitting on: beyond the legal aspect, it’s the sender’s reputation that collapses. Respecting consent, ensuring visibility of the unsubscribe link, audience segmentation: these are all safeguards to avoid disaster. Adjusting the sending frequency limits fatigue, and a prior test prevents mass sends filled with errors.
Reading an email on mobile should become as natural as turning a page: structure, space out, personalize. Adapt the tone and form to your audience, respond quickly – as patience has its limits: 53% of internet users expect a response within the hour. Messaging, the realm of the instantaneous, forgives neither negligence nor indifference.
